ChatGPT prediction for Fluminense vs Juventude, 17 October 2025.
Fluminense return to the Maracanã as clear market favorites, priced at 1.35, with Juventude a long shot at 9.77 and the Draw at 4.73. Translating those prices to implied probabilities, the book is saying roughly 74% Fluminense, 10% Juventude, and 21% Draw, with a small overround built in. That is a heavy endorsement of the home side, but Brasileirão dynamics are often more nuanced: it’s a league where margins are thin, tempos can flatten matches, and the draw rate consistently ranks among the highest in top-flight football worldwide.
Fluminense’s possession-first approach typically controls territory but can also compress the match into long spells of sterile dominance. Against compact, counter-oriented visitors like Juventude, the outcomes often cluster around small scorelines. That tactical profile inflates the likelihood of 0-0s and 1-1s, especially when the favorite lacks early penetration or faces a well-organized low block. Even when Flu lead, their game-state management can slow the tempo further, keeping the underdog within reach and protecting the draw late.
From a numbers perspective, the price on Fluminense demands a win around 74% of the time to break even at 1.35. That threshold is steep in Serie A, where travel, pitch conditions, and conservative game plans routinely suppress win probabilities for big favorites. Meanwhile, the Draw at 4.73 implies only ~21%, which looks light relative to a realistic band of 26–28% in this tactical matchup. If you make the Draw 27% fair (roughly +270), the expected value on +373 becomes meaningfully positive: EV ≈ 0.27×3.73 − 0.73, comfortably above zero on a $1 stake.
Juventude at 9.77 is a tempting longshot because their blueprint—defend deep, attack in bursts, lean on set pieces—can punish a favorite that overcommits. But for a single core position, the Draw is the sharper risk-reward. It captures both the stalemate path and the late-equalizer script that so often defines tight Brazilian fixtures, while not needing a full away upset to cash.
In short, the market is shading heavily toward the home badge, but the style and situational realities pull the distribution back toward equilibrium. With a $1 staking plan and an eye on profit over time, the most rational punt is the Draw at 4.73. It aligns with how these teams are likely to interact on the pitch, exploits a common favorite premium in this league, and offers a clear positive expectation without requiring a low-probability away win.
